Abu Dhabi Chamber discuss expanding economic relations with Slovenia



The Abu Dhabi Chamber of Commerce and Industry received on Wednesday a trade delegation from the Republic of Slovenia which included representatives of 30 companies and establishments from different economic, industrial and services sector.

The meeting witnesses the attendance of managers of more than 40 Emirati companies operating in Abu Dhabi.

His Excellency Dr. Mubarak Al-Ameri, Board Member at the Abu Dhabi Chamber, said in a speech he delivered at the beginning of the meeting that the visit of the Slovenian trade delegation to the Abu Dhabi Chamber reflects their awareness on increasing the volume of economic and trade cooperation between the Emirate of Abu Dhabi and the Republic of Slovenia and contributing to boosting economic relations to reach the ambitious levels of both sides.

Al-Ameri added that the Emirate of Abu Dhabi works on developing the infrastructure and a competitive business environment to bring them to the best international levels, noting that such an infrastructure would help in facilitating the move of passengers and goods considering Khalifa Port as one of the biggest and most advanced ports in the world.

Abu Dhabi is also working on providing a lot of facilities to set up an investment climate with international standards that encourages international and regional businessmen to establish their companies in Abu Dhabi. There are indeed a large number of international companies which took from the emirate a base for their regional and international operations,” he said.

The Board Member pointed out that despite the economic development in the Emirate of Abu Dhabi and the Republic of Slovenia; however, the volume of trade exchange between them does not reflect the available capabilities, which requires spending more efforts by the companies of the private sector to bring the volume of trade exchange to the desired levels.

Al-Ameri called on businessmen and companies in Slovenia to increase their economic cooperation and discover the unlimited opportunities in the emirate. He also encouraged Emirati businessmen and companies to boost their investments in Slovenia.

Abu Dhabi Chamber Board Members Their Excellency Hamed Al-Shaer and Khan Zaman attended the meeting along with His Excellency Mohammed Helal Al-Muhairi, Director General of the Abu Dhabi Chamber, and a number of executive directors and officials at the Chamber.

For her part, Her Excellency Tatjana Miskova, Ambassador-Designate of the Republic of Slovenia to the UAE (Non Resident), emphasized on the interest of Slovenian companies to increase their presence in the UAE markets, praising the high international level of Khalifa Port. She also emphasized on the desire of such companies to benefit from the services and incentives which are provided by the related authorities in the Emirate of Abu Dhabi to invest in a number of sectors and fields that are envisioned by the Abu Dhabi Economic Vision 2030.
